This bust is a high-quality replica of the portrait bust of Madame du Barry (1743-1793) by the classicist sculptor Augustin Pajou, from around 1773, now in the Louvre (MR 2651; N 15483), exhibited in Salle 220, Aile Richelieu. Pajou was a French artist and is considered one of the most important representatives of his time. As a sculptor of Louis XV (1710-1774), he produced this particular representation as the last of a series of busts of Madame du Barry. She is considered the last official mistress of the French king. The lady was particularly renowned for her legendary beauty and also acted as an important patron of the arts.

The bust of Madame du Barry rests on a stone plinth. She is dressed in an antique, tight-fitting robe under which her breast is clearly visible. Her tall hairstyle is in keeping with the fashion of the time, with tightly combed-back hair and voluminous curls falling in single strands over her shoulder, accentuating her slender, elegant neck. Her confidently raised head, lofty gaze with raised brows and resolutely pursed mouth are emphasised by her almost arrogant posture, as she was fully aware of her elevated status.

In 1773, the bust of the Louvre was exhibited at the Paris Salon and was very well received. Afterwards, numerous repetitions were made, for example also in bisque porcelain from Sèvres, whereby Pajou himself made a completely new model in terracotta or plaster for this purpose (cf. MET inv. no. 43.163.3a, b). Several other plaster casts also exist, such as in the Victoria and Albert Museum in London (A.98-1921), which reveals the great importance of the artist as well as the reputation of the mistress for posterity.
